Light Microscopy (Optical)

Light microscopy (Optical) includes bright field, wide field, confocal, fluorescence and phase contrast microscopy. Confocal laser scanning and spinning disc microscopy achieve high resolution and 3D imaging by taking optical sections of a sample. In choosing light microscopes consider magnification, image analysis software, lenses, condensers and eyepieces.
